GXBank and Zurich Malaysia Forge 10-Year Exclusive Bancassurance Partnership

GX Bank Berhad (GXBank) has joined forces with Zurich General Insurance Malaysia Berhad and Zurich Life Insurance Malaysia Berhad to unveil a 10-year exclusive bancassurance tripartite partnership aimed at co-creating micro protection products for underserved Malaysians.

The first offering, slated for launch in the third quarter of the year, seeks to “protect underserved individuals from unauthorized transactions resulting from cyber-crime, as well as transactions initiated by electronic scam messages,” the press statement reads. The collaboration aims to “develop innovative digital insurance products that are simple, easy-to-understand, and affordable.”

PwC’s 2023 survey revealed that 84% of the uninsured population in Malaysia are aged between 18 and 34 years old. 58% of Malaysian adults lack any form of life or takaful insurance coverage. Furthermore, the surge in cybercrimes in Malaysia – with online fraud cases doubling over five years since 2019 – amounted to losses estimated at RM1.3 billion in 2023 alone.

Pei-Si Lai, CEO of GXBank, underscored the significance of the partnership in delivering tailored banking solutions for underserved Malaysians. “Our partnership enables us to address safety pain points regarding digital banking, and safeguard Malaysians against life and financial uncertainties.”

“This long-term partnership with GXBank enables us to be flexible and agile in how we can co-create relevant affordable insurance products. Together, we look forward to instilling confidence and empower Malaysians to take charge of their financial future, and support Malaysians in caring for what truly matters in their lives,” said Junior Cho, Country CEO & Head of Zurich Malaysia.
